Background technique
For the personal safety for guaranteeing interruption maintenance line construction personnel, must respectively hold in job site and it is possible that power transmission to stopping The branch line of electric line will hang ground line, and to hang ground path hanging frequently with throwing for 500kV transmission line of electricity, there is ground connection End, insulating cord, ground line and wire clamp composition, need operating personnel to climb to cross-arm exit, mention insulating cord and put down and have been opened Wire clamp, so that wire clamp is fastened conducting wire using gravity impact conducting wire, firmly pull insulating cord when removing, make conducting wire shake off wire clamp and It is detached from.
Though such method is common, there is also several drawbacks: first is that, by the power for drawing insulating cord upward, making to lead when line taking is pressed from both sides Line is shaken off out in the clip of clamping, if to hold dynamics that is especially tight or mentioning insulating cord upwards not big enough for wire clamp, often makes Shake off the difficult situation not fallen at conducting wire, and insulating cord can only be pullled by using bigger strength repeatedly to make conducting wire shake off line Folder;Second is that such line taking folder mode inevitably causes conducting wire to rub back and forth on the surface of wire clamp, certain damage will cause to conducting wire, unexpectedly And lead to new defect;Third is that ground line or personal safety wire leakage tear situation open and happen occasionally, because 500kV and Above Transmission Lines compare Long, often still multi-point operation simultaneously, the ground line that need to be hung or personal safety wire quantity are more, and hang position from the ground It is very high, do not see that being easy to leakage tears open, once there is omission, completely is also not easy to find apart from too long carefully, and route may finally be caused Occur ground fault in transmission process, it can not power transmission.Therefore, existing earthing clamp, with operation is not easy, safety is low, no The disadvantages of easily managing.

The power transmission line ground wire folder that can be positioned and be easily installed and disassemble, including clamping plate one and clamping plate two, one He of clamping plate It is equipped with connection sheet, clamping plate one and clamping plate two in the middle part of clamping plate two to be flexibly connected by connection sheet, in two connection sheet of clamping plate one and clamping plate A torsional spring is arranged in connecting place, and the stay end of torsional spring two sides is individually positioned on clamping plate one and clamping plate two, by clamping plate one and folder It is partially strutted on plate two, the clamping plate one is equipped with through-hole, and one periphery of clamping plate of through hole is arranged a sliding sleeve, torsional spring side Stay end is placed on sliding sleeve, and a bracing wire is connected at the top of sliding sleeve, and the clamping plate one is flexibly connected a support rod, Support rod end sets card slot, and clamping plate two is equipped with the fixture block with pocket matches, and the support rod is set to below connection sheet.
In the present invention, clamping plate one and clamping plate two are used to be connected to conducting wire, and clamping plate one and clamping plate two utilize connection sheet activity It is connected, and is strutted part on clamping plate one and clamping plate two naturally by the stay on torsional spring and torsional spring, therefore press from both sides under natural conditions The lower part of plate one and clamping plate two is in closed state, when pulling up the bracing wire on sliding sleeve, sliding sleeve along clamping plate one to The through-hole on clamping plate one is exposed in upper sliding, and torsional spring stay end loses the support of sliding sleeve and springs into the through-hole of clamping plate one, Torsional spring stay loses support and then free extension is opened, so that entire earthing clamp is convenient in the state of scattering is loosened by earthing clamp It is removed on conducting wire, such line taking mode can make conducting wire be detached from earthing clamp without using large force, and it is easy to operate, and not Conducting wire can be caused to damage, it is highly-safe, when earthing clamp to be installed on conducting wire, need to only be set using the card slot card of support rod On fixture block, and then make partially to strut under clamping plate one and clamping plate two, then transfer on earthing clamp to conducting wire, in self gravity and Flick support rod upwards, the earthing clamp for losing support is closed under the effect of torsion spring, clamping plate one and folder Plate two is closely clipped on conducting wire, is grounded the automatic installation of wire clamp.
The sliding sleeve rectangular in cross-section, sliding sleeve is equipped with limiting groove towards the side of torsional spring, in sliding sleeve Portion is equipped with mounting hole, and clamping plate one is threaded through in mounting hole, respectively connects a fixed block in one two sides of clamping plate, fixed block is equipped with item Shape limiting slot is arranged with several balls in bar limit slot, and ball can freely roll in bar limit slot, sliding sleeve installation Hole inner wall is contacted with ball, and non-contact-point between sliding sleeve inner wall of the hole installing and clamping plate one and fixed block.
Limiting groove can be avoided torsional spring stay and be detached from from sliding sleeve, the stability of earthing clamp be improved, due to cunning Moving sleeve inner wall of the hole installing is contacted with ball, and non-contact-point between sliding sleeve inner wall of the hole installing and clamping plate one and fixed block, because When this sliding sleeve is slided up and down along clamping plate one, the resistance being subject to is only force of rolling friction, facilitates the movement of sliding sleeve, is reduced Active force needed for bracing wire pulls sliding sleeve, keeps removing for earthing clamp more convenient laborsaving.
The through-hole is strip-shaped hole, and side of the clamping plate one towards torsional spring stay is arranged in through-hole, and torsional spring is close to through-hole side Stay end connect a miniature idler wheel, wire clamp ground line bolt is connected on the outside of the clamping plate two.
Miniature idler wheel can reduce the frictional force between torsional spring stay end and sliding sleeve, further decrease bracing wire lifting and slide Required active force when moving sleeve.
The support rod is connect with clamping plate one by bolt one, and support rod can be rotated freely around bolt one, the card slot For the trough with straight angle being directed downward, the fixture block is cylindrical, and when clamping plate one and two lower part of clamping plate are said good-bye out, fixture block is placed in card slot Interior, the card slot inner wall is equipped with anti-skid bulge, and support rod is then separated with fixture block by upward active force.
A conducting wire link slot is partially respectively provided under the clamping plate one and clamping plate two, conducting wire link slot is arranged in one He of clamping plate The inside of clamping plate two.
Hemispherical projections are provided on the inner wall of the sliding sleeve mounting hole, hemispherical projections are arranged in inner wall of the hole installing Side far from torsional spring stay is connected with a horizontal positive stop strip in one outer tip end of clamping plate, and positive stop strip height is greater than hemisphere Shape height of projection, and positive stop strip height is less than the spacing of sliding sleeve inner wall of the hole installing and clamping plate one, the hemispherical projections are set It sets in sliding sleeve lower end.
Positive stop strip in hemispherical projections and clamping plate one is with the use of when can be avoided bracing wire and pulling sliding sleeve, sliding sleeve Cylinder is detached from from one top of clamping plate, and positive stop strip height is greater than hemispherical projections height, and positive stop strip height is installed less than sliding sleeve The spacing of hole inner wall and clamping plate one, therefore sliding sleeve, in sliding, hemispherical projections and positive stop strip can't hinder sliding sleeve The movement of cylinder, when sliding sleeve lower end is moved to one top of clamping plate, hemispherical projections are stuck in positive stop strip side, avoid sliding sleeve Cylinder is continued to move to and is detached from.
Further, the bar limit slot is parallel with clamping plate one, and the through-hole on clamping plate one is aligned with torsional spring stay.
Further, the connection sheet on the clamping plate one and clamping plate two is respectively two, the connection sheet of clamping plate one and clamping plate two Between connected by bolt two, connection sheet can be rotated around bolt two, and a connecting shaft, the torsional spring are equipped between two bolts two It is set in connecting shaft.
Further, it is also connected with a sunpender in the connecting shaft, is connected with metal collar, metal collar top at the top of sunpender Portion is connected with rope sling, and metal collar and the rope sling of being drawstring through is connected with a ground terminal.
For operator by the downward unwrapping wire folder of rope sling, its internal bracing wire is in relaxed state at this time, avoids sliding sleeve It is detached from through hole too early, the rope sling flexibility is strong, firm resistance to jail, and waterproof performance is good.
Nylon rope of the bracing wire using diameter not less than 6 millimeters is made, and has and insulate, tension, antiwear characteristic, and rope sling is straight Diameter is greater than insulating cord.
The ground terminal is equipped with ground terminal ground line bolt and locator, and mounting groove, top are equipped in the middle part of ground terminal Portion is equipped with adjusting screw rod, and adjusting screw rod bottom passes through ground terminal and is placed in mounting groove, and ground terminal passes through mounting groove and adjusting screw rod It is fixed on cross-arm tower material.
The locator installed on ground terminal, can be convenient for the specific position of inquiry power transmission line ground wire or personal safety wire It sets, locator can be bolted or strong magnetic suck is on earthing clamp ground terminal.Locator sets the alarm function that falls off, it is ensured that Locator has dustproof and waterproof constantly on ground terminal, stable signal transmission characteristic, and power module is arranged in locator, is Locator provides energy during the working time, and operator can inquire transmission line of electricity in the APP of mobile phone backstage according to GPS positioning The position of ground line prevents the occurrence of earthing or grounding means leakage is torn open.

In use, operating personnel climbs with earthing clamp to cross-arm exit first, first adjusting screw rod 84 is turned on, is allowed Ground terminal mounting groove 83 contains cross-arm tower material, tightens adjusting screw rod 84, is reliably connected ground terminal 8 with steel tower, then makes to slide Sleeve 5 covers one through-hole of clamping plate, and the miniature idler wheel 41 of torsional spring stay compresses in the limiting groove 52 of sliding sleeve 5, and torsional spring is in Tight stress, clamping plate 1 and clamping plate 2 are closed, and operator presses off part on clamping plate one and clamping plate two with hand, push up fixture block 21 At the card slot of support rod 6, wire clamp is kept open under the action of support rod 6.Operator holds rope sling 34, utilizes rope Set 34 slowly puts down earthing clamp, and earthing clamp is directed at conducting wire, then unclamps earthing clamp, conducting wire downward using gravity suddenly Into the earthing clamp of opening, and support rod 6 is rushed open, support rod 6 loses supporting role, and part is acted in torsional spring under earthing clamp Under, firm grip conducting wire hangs up properly ground line.After operation, operator steps on to cross-arm again, firmly pulls bracing wire, draws Line drives sliding sleeve 5 to skid off, and skids off the torsional spring stay with miniature idler wheel 41 from through-hole 11, earthing clamp is because losing at this time The elastic force of torsional spring and scatter, conducting wire is detached from from earthing clamp.
